- 1、本文档共60页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
桂林电子科技大学 信息与通信学院 ASIC原理及应用 主讲:信息与通信学院 谢跃雷(副教授) 第二章 ASIC算法模型设计 数字系统的描述方法 数字系统算法设计 算法流程图 算法结构 2.1 数字系统模型 解: 实现该系统功能应由三个存贮单元R1、R2和R3,分别存放输入信号x(t-1)、x(t)、x(t+1)的数据,然后再根据以下检测规则决定输出Z (1) 当x(t-1) =x(t)=x(t+1)=1,输出Z=1即Z=R1R2R3。 (2)其它情况Z=0。 图 2.1.3 序列检测系统算法流程图 三、算法流程图 2.判断块 3.条件块 4.开始与结束 图 2.2.3开始块与结束块 三种基本结构 循环结构 四、数字系统的算法流程图 实例1:设计一个自动报纸销售机 实例2: 雷达接收回波信号中找出目标反射信号,即一个数学问题,从m个输入n位二进制数x中找出最大值和最小值的系统。 2.2 算法模型设计 一、算法模型设计方法 例1:设计一4X4扫描键盘系统,能够响应按键,输出相应的键值。 需要考虑以下问题: (1)如何防按键抖动? 硬件防按键抖动,延迟防抖 (2)如何进行键盘扫描? 依次置col=0001、0010、0100、 1000,查看row的值 (3)如何计算键值? 例2: 设计一个十字路口交通灯控制系统。 东西道为主道,南北道为副道。如果东西道(EW)及南北道(NS)均有车,则东西道每次通行60秒(绿灯),南北道每次通行40秒(绿灯)。如果仅有一个通道有车,则禁止无车通道(红灯);如果两通道均无车,则禁止南北道。通道转换时,绿灯通道均需停车3秒(黄灯)。 分析:由题目得十字路口交通灯控制器大致流程图 十字路口交通灯算法流程图: 2.解析法 当遇到难以分解的计算过程时,采用数学分析对其进行数值近似,转换成多项式或某种迭代过程,然后画出其算法流程图的方法称之为解析法 设x=3,令y0=1,其计算过程为: 序号 y W=x/y V=y+W U=V/2 0 1 3 4 2 1 2 1.5 3.5 1.75 2 1.75 1.714 3.464 1.7321 3 1.7321 1.73200 3.4641 1.73205 3.综合法 按动weight按钮,产生weight=1信号,系统进行体重测量。表示体重的模拟信息Vw经A/D转换为另一组数字量,经存储、码制变换和处理,显示3位十进制数表示的体重数据,此时单位显示kg。 对于上述测得的身高、体重两组数字量,进行数据计算和判别。由计算结果判别出被测对象胖、瘦程度,并正确显示偏胖、适中或偏瘦3种情况之一。 判断规则如下:L实测身高、W实测体重,K1、K2为常数,对于男性成人K1=105cm,女性成人k1=100,k2=3~8cm。则有: a. L-k1=W 标准体型 b. L-K1-K2=W=L-K1+k2 体型适中 c. W=L-k1-k2 偏瘦 d.WL-K1+k2 偏胖 2.4 算法结构 顺序算法结构是指在执行算法的整个过程中,同一时间只进行一种或一组相关的子运算。图2.4.1是顺序算法结构 二、并行算法结构 并行算法是指在同一时间段中,有多条路径在同时进行运算,在这些同时执行的子运算操作之间是相互独立的。 注意点: 并行算法完成运算的时间: 在并行算法结构中,若待处理数据是单元素Di,它完成运算的时间为 t = L′ ? ⊿t 其中L′ 是并行算法流程经过的运算段数 若含有n个元素的数据流输入时,并行结构算法总的运算时间为 Tp=n ? t =n ? L′ ? ⊿t 三、流水线操作算法结构 例如要对1000个数据x(n)进行处理,处理输出结果y(n) ,每个数据需要4个处理步骤 流水线操作算法结构是针对连续输入数据流系统而言的。它将整个运算分解成若干子运算,系统在同一时间可对先后输入的数据流元素进行不同子运算。具有如下特点: (3) 在流水线的每一个功能部件后面都要有一个缓冲寄存器,用于保存本段的执行结果。 (4) 流水线中各段
您可能关注的文档
- (2014必备)中考物理复习方案-第4单元-力-力与运动课件-教科版.ppt
- (2016)第14课《植树的牧羊人》第一课时讲解.ppt
- (a-b-c符号的确定第8课时).ppt
- (部编)人教2011课标版一年级上册《zh-ch-sh-r》.ppt
- (部编)人教2011课标版一年级上册4、d--t--n--l.-(1).ppt
- (部编)人教2011课标版一年级上册10、大还是小.ppt
- (部编)人教语文2011课标版一年级下册《5.小公鸡和小鸭子》.ppt
- (部编)人教语文2011课标版一年级下册《荷叶圆圆》第二课时-(5).pptx
- (部编)人教语文2011课标版一年级下册《静夜思》-(8).ppt
- (部编)人教语文2011课标版一年级下册《四个太阳》第一课时.ppt
文档评论(0)